GTA: Chinatown Wars highest scoring DS game ever
And it's not even out yet
Well, we gave GTA: Chinatown Wars one of our much coveted Platinum Awards, and judging by the initial impressions we took a look at around the blogosphere, we weren’t the only ones who pegged the first DS GTA title as a rip-roaring success.
Both GameRankingsand Metacritichave made a career out of compiling aggregate scores for video games, and only hours after the game’s official release, both sites have proven it to be the highest scoring DS game of all time (just as analysts were predicting).
Weighing in at an impressive 94.54 per cent on GameRankings (a score calculated from 12 independent reviews) and 95 per cent on Metacritic (based on 15 reviews), Chrono Trigger has been well and truly knocked off the top spot.
It’s still early days for GTA: Chinatown Wars, of course, and that score could drop if a few rogue critics decide not to join the pack, but the fact that it went straight into the number one spot is something Rockstar Leeds should be very proud of - especially to say it hasn't even been released yet on its native shores.
